by J. Ellis Barker (Translator), C. G. Grey (Introduction by), H. L. Hanna (Editor)

Rittmeister Manfred Freiherr von Richthofen, the highest scoring fighter pilot of the First World War, became an almost legendary figure after his death in action at the age of twenty-five. Although heavily edited before its release by the Imperial German government, this autobiography, begun by Richthofen while convalescing in the hospital after he suffered a severe head wound in July, 1917, is an interesting look into the mind of the man known to history as "The Red Baron". This English translation, first published in 1918, has the original preface and footnotes by C.G. Grey, which reflect the wartime animosity felt by the Allies toward their German enemy. Additional footnotes, an Appendix of Wartime photographs and an Index are also included in this new edition for 2013.
